Rabat – US Secretary of State Antony Blinken has tested positive for COVID-19, the US State Department announced on May 4. Blinken’s diagnosis is likely to hamper his planned attendance at a high-level meeting in Marrakech in the coming week.
The Secretary of State is fully vaccinated and boosted against the COVID-19, though he is experiencing “mild symptoms,” State Department Spokesperson Ned Price said.
The White House confirmed on Tuesday that US President Joe Biden, meanwhile, tested positive, adding that he did not meet with Blinken in several days.
Blinken, however, on Wednesday met with Swedish Foreign Affairs Minister Ann Linde to discuss continued assistance for Ukraine, Transatlantic relationships, and global issues.
Price said that a “major” political speech by Blinken on US-China bilateral relations, planned for May 5, has been postponed, including other international meetings.
Blinken was expected to visit Morocco on May 11 to participate in a meeting of the Global Coalition against Daesh. The event is expected to convene high-level officials from across the word in Marrakech.
It remains to be seen whether Blinken will cancel his visit to Morocco due his COVID-19 diagnosis, or whether he will participate in the meeting remotely.
The US State Department established that Blinken is “grateful” to the medical staff all around the world who encouraged vaccination. The statement added that Blinken will maintain his isolation and a virtual work schedule, as long as his health situation will allow him to return to his duties.
Tedros Adhanom Ghebreyesus, director-general of the World Health Organization (WHO) affirmed via twitter on May 4 that COVID-19 cases and deaths worldwide continue to decline and that this can be considered good news.
“However, reduced testing in many countries makes us blind to patterns of transmission & evolution,” he said.
The Omicron subvariant BA.2.12.1 was identified in at least a dozen of countries, but still the US has the highest rates of the variant. The CDC confirmed early Tuesday that 29% of last week COVID-19 cases were originally BA.2.12.1, particularly in the center of New York (58%).
